21、调控代谢网络中布尔控制学习与合成基因电路群体设计

调控代谢网络中布尔控制学习与合成基因电路群体设计

一、调控代谢网络中的布尔控制学习
(一)Answer - Set编程实现

Answer - Set编程(ASP)是一个声明式框架,用于解决组合满足问题。它基于稳定模型语义,基本思想是将问题以逻辑格式表达,其逻辑模型即为原问题的解。问题以逻辑程序表示,稳定模型被称为答案集。现代ASP求解器如clingo支持多种推理模式组合,包括常规和投影枚举、交集和并集、多标准优化以及子集最小和最大模型枚举等。

ASP的稳定模型语义与析取编程相结合,能够表达两级量化布尔公式(2 - QBF问题),即∃x, ∀y, φ(x, y) ,其中φ(x, y) 是无量词命题公式。2 - QBF的编码依赖于饱和技术,对于固定的x和y,当且仅当φ(x, y) 成立时,返回最大(饱和)答案集;若存在y使φ(x, y) 不成立,则返回较小答案集。根据子集最小稳定语义,2 - QBF问题可满足当且仅当只有饱和答案集是子集最小的。

(二)案例研究
  1. 输入模拟
    • 设计了六个动态r - FBA模拟,对应不同的初始可用输入代谢物和调节蛋白集合。例如,实验1假设所有输入代谢物(Carbon1、Carbon2、Oxygen)都可用;实验2假设初始化时Carbon1和Carbon2存在,但Oxygen不存在。
    • 使用FlexFlux,初始生物量值为0.1,时间步长为0.01进行系统模拟。每个模拟包含200个代谢稳态,模拟结果进行二值化处理,并去除连续相同的布尔状态。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值